1. The Client's Situation
The client had been sued for marriage nullity by the younger sibling of a deceased spouse and urgently requested assistance from an Incheon attorney.
How the Client Came to the Incheon Law Firm
The account given by the client, who consulted with the Incheon attorney, is as follows.
The client had been in a common-law relationship with A for 15 years.
About a year earlier, however, A was diagnosed with terminal cancer and was hospitalized, and the client devotedly cared for A.
A then proposed to the client that they register their marriage, and the two registered the marriage with their mutual consent.
Less than a month after the marriage was registered, however, A passed away.
Afterward, A's younger sibling filed this action, claiming that the client had kept A under control and registered the marriage.
The Issues Identified by the Incheon Attorney

First, even though the client and A had registered the marriage by mutual agreement, A's younger sibling was claiming that the marriage registration was void.
The Incheon attorney therefore gathered relevant evidence, including a transcript of a recording and the marriage registration form, and devised a strategy to prove that the marriage was not void.
2. The Applicable Statutes Explained by the Incheon Law Firm
🔗A marriage nullity action is a lawsuit brought to obtain legal recognition that the marriage was void from the outset.
Unlike divorce or annulment of marriage, if a marriage is declared void, it is deemed never to have existed from the beginning.
A marriage nullity action may be filed at any time by a party, a legal representative, or a relative within the fourth degree of kinship.
1. If there is no agreement to marry between the parties
2. If the marriage violates the provisions of Article 809 (1)
3. If there is or was a direct affinity relationship between the parties
4. If there was a lineal blood relationship through adoptive parents between the parties
3. Assistance Provided by the Incheon Law Firm
After identifying the specific facts through consultation with the client, the Incheon attorney established the direction of the pleadings so as to obtain dismissal of the claim.
The attorney then assisted the client by making the following arguments.
The Incheon Law Firm's Argument 1 | Intent to Marry
The plaintiff argued that, because A lacked mental capacity due to poor health, A was not in a position to prevent the marriage registration.
The attorney emphasized, however, that the recording made at the time of the marriage registration showed that A clearly expressed his own intent and proposed to the client that they register the marriage.
The Incheon Law Firm's Argument 2 | No Control Was Exercised
The plaintiff argued that the client had kept A under control and blocked contact between the plaintiff and A.
The plaintiff, however, was unable to offer any proof as to how contact had been blocked or how control had been exercised.
The attorney also emphasized that the restrictions on hospital visits due to COVID-19 at the time had to be taken into account, and that this showed the client had not blocked contact.
4. The Result of the Incheon Law Firm's Assistance: "Winning the Case"
Accepting the Incheon law firm's arguments, the court issued a judgment stating, "The plaintiff's claim is dismissed. The costs of the litigation shall be borne by the plaintiff."
